不相关并行机排序问题研究:设备、资源与优化
PDF格式 | 1.62MB |
更新于2024-06-17
| 91 浏览量 | 举报
"这篇文章探讨了在不相关并行机环境中,如何有效地进行排序任务,同时考虑设备和资源的约束,以最小化完工时间。研究中引入了特定资源、设置资源和共享资源的概念,并通过塑料加工厂的例子来阐述这些资源在实际生产中的应用。问题通过建立混合整数线性规划模型来解决,并提出了一种三相算法,该算法在广泛的计算实验中显示出了良好的性能。文章强调了在工业中,调度和资源优化的重要性,并指出不相关并行机调度问题(UPM)是一个关键的研究领域。"
文章详细分析了带设备和资源的不相关并行机排序问题,该问题涉及到多个作业在多台机器上并行处理,每个作业只能在一台机器上完成且不能中断。处理时间和设置时间受到机器和作业的特性影响。在这样的环境中,资源管理是关键,资源可分为三类:
1. 特定资源:与特定机器关联,例如塑料加工中的模具,是执行特定任务所必需的。
2. 设置资源:用于作业开始前的设置过程,如清洁设备,确保机器准备就绪。
3. 共享资源:非特定于某个任务或机器,如工人,可能在多个任务或过程中通用。
由于资源有限,如何在满足这些约束的同时最小化完工时间成为了一个挑战。作者提出了一种混合整数线性规划(MILP)模型,这是一个数学优化工具,可以用来求解这个问题。此外,他们还设计了一种三相算法,结合了精确的数学方法,以高效地解决问题。
实验表明,这个模型和算法在各种资源组合的情况下都能取得良好的效果。即使在处理400个作业的大规模实例中,它也能与已知下限进行比较,并展现出优越的性能。这验证了所提方法的有效性和实用性,尤其适用于处理有资源限制的工业调度问题。
本文对不相关并行机调度问题的深入研究和提出的解决方案,对于理解和优化现实世界中的复杂生产环境具有重要意义,尤其是在资源有限的情况下寻求最优调度策略。同时,提出的混合整数线性规划模型和三相算法为后续研究提供了有价值的参考框架。
相关推荐










cpongm
- 粉丝: 6
最新资源
- 掌握PerfView:高效配置.NET程序性能数据
- SQL2000与Delphi结合的超市管理系统设计
- 冲压模具设计的高效拉伸计算器软件介绍
- jQuery文字图片滚动插件:单行多行及按钮控制
- 最新C++参考手册:包含C++11标准新增内容
- 实现Android嵌套倒计时及活动启动教程
- TMS320F2837xD DSP技术手册详解
- 嵌入式系统实验入门:掌握VxWorks及通信程序设计
- Magento支付宝接口使用教程
- GOIT MARKUP HW-06 项目文件综述
- 全面掌握JBossESB组件与配置教程
- 古风水墨风艾灸养生响应式网站模板
- 讯飞SDK中的音频增益调整方法与实践
- 银联加密解密工具集 - Des算法与Bitmap查看器
- 全面解读OA系统源码中的权限管理与人员管理技术
- PHP HTTP扩展1.7.0版本发布,支持PHP5.3环境